Ottorino Respighi stands alongside Giacomo Puccini and Antonio Vivaldi as one of the best known and most performed Italian composers. Yet, compared to that of other composers of Respighi's stature, relatively little has been written about the man and his music. This work provides documentation and annotation of all of this great composer's articles, books, theses, and dissertations with references to Respighi and his music published during the last century throughout the world. Although Ottorino Respighi is one of the most performed Italian composers since Puccini, relatively little critical attention has been paid to him or his music, perhaps because of his association with Italian fascism. In this annotated bibliography, Barrow...has attempted to document all printed references to Respighi and his compostions.
